God: Judge

Take God at His Word
Getting children to eat what is good for them can be quite a problem. Convincing them that you mean business takes more strength of character than some parents possess. Yet the mother who lets her child indulge his preference for sweets, instead of such body-building foods as milk, meat, and vegetables, does not really love him as much as the mother who does her best to see that he gets a balanced diet. The parents who give in to a child on matters that affect his future health and character are not loving. They are merely encouraging him to go on getting his way in all future contests of will. They are laying the foundation for trouble for the rest of his life. So it is with God. Unless people believe that He means what He says, they will run to all kinds of excesses, and ruin their lives for time and eternity. Although the Bible consistently proclaims that unbelief and sin, if unrepented of in this life, will result in eternal loss, too many people refuse to take God at His Word. They choose to believe He is too soft-hearted ever to condemn anyone to eternal punishment.

God the Judge
Returning home from school one day, my little boy came to me with the evidence of what he had had for lunch smeared all over his mouth. I told him to go wash his face and come back to show me the results. He returned in a hurry, saying, "I am all clean now, Daddy." "Are you?" I asked. "Sure. I washed just like you told me to." From his point of view he was clean, but from where I stood he still looked dirty. It is not what we think of ourselves that counts, but what God our Creator thinks of us.
